Quaint
This is an older-styled hotel with studio-type rooms. The service was nice. Even though our rooms were not ready, we were upgraded to a suite. This isnt a large hotel with a large lobby, restaurant, pool or anything. Its like an apartment complex where the rooms have kitchens and suites had living rooms w/ desks. The place boasts its gym, but we didnt use it. It somewhat near NYCs attractions (short walk to Koreatown, ~20 min walk to Central Park) in a quiet neighborhood. Recommended for people who just need a nice place to sleep.

Dumont Plaza is a winner
The Dumont is a great little hotel. There is never a line at the desk, its VERY close to Laguardia for being in the city and the rooms are like little apartments. If youre looking for trendy, this isnt for you. But if youre looking for a really nice, clean, up todate large room, then stay here. Very nice rooms, with a fridge and totally modern and stylish. The location is ideal, youre in the middle, so you can go up town or down town with ease (4,5,6 train just two block away). I have stayed all over the city and this is one of the best deals around, and its hassle free.
